The Critical Role of Oil Changes
Think of your engine oil as the lifeblood of your vehicle. Its primary job is to lubricate moving parts, effectively reducing internal friction that otherwise wastes energy, a fundamental principle of how to improve fuel efficiency and engine performance optimization. When oil becomes contaminated with dirt, debris, or sludge over time, it loses its viscosity and effectiveness, forcing your engine to consume more fuel to overcome added resistance.
Aim to change your oil every 3,000 to 5,000 miles, or strictly follow your manufacturer’s service interval recommendations. Checking your oil levels at least once a month is an easy, proactive habit that prevents long-term engine strain and keeps your miles-per-gallon (MPG) metrics at their peak, showing you how to improve fuel efficiency with simple checks.
Air Filter Replacements and Combustion
Your engine needs a precise mixture of air and fuel to create the combustion necessary to move your vehicle. An engine air filter prevents dust, pollutants, and debris from entering the cylinder chambers. If this filter becomes clogged or dirty, it restricts airflow, causing the engine to "choke" and consume an excessive amount of fuel to compensate. Proper air filtration is vital for engine performance optimization.
Checking your air filter every 12,000 to 15,000 miles is a low-cost, high-reward maintenance task. A clean air filter optimizes the combustion process, ensuring your car runs as efficiently as the day it rolled off the assembly line, a clear example of how to improve fuel efficiency. Why Spark Plug Health Matters
Spark plugs are responsible for igniting the air-fuel mixture within your engine’s cylinders. If your spark plugs are worn, fouled, or improperly gapped, they can cause engine misfires. Even a subtle misfire that you might not notice while driving can significantly degrade fuel efficiency and increase harmful emissions. The Truth About Driving Speeds and Aerodynamic Drag
We often think that arriving a few minutes earlier is worth the extra fuel cost, but the physics of speed suggest otherwise. Increasing your speed from 55 to 65 mph can increase aerodynamic drag by a staggering 36 percent.
Consider this real-world example: If you drive 100 miles at 70 mph compared to 65 mph, you only save seven minutes. However, if your car’s efficiency drops from 25 MPG to 20 MPG because of that speed, you end up paying significantly more for that same trip. Use Cruise Control Strategically
Cruise control is a fantastic tool for maintaining a steady speed on flat highways, which is where it truly shines in maximizing fuel efficiency and showing how to improve fuel efficiency on long drives. However, you should cut the cruise control on hilly terrain. When driving up steep inclines, cruise control will often command the engine to downshift and push hard to maintain the exact speed, whereas a human driver can allow the car to lose a little momentum on the way up and regain it on the way down, saving a noticeable amount of fuel in the process. Choosing the Right Tires
If you are due for a tire change, consider opting for low-rolling resistance tires. These are specifically engineered to minimize the energy lost as heat while the tire rolls along the road. While they may require a slightly higher initial investment, the long-term fuel savings make them a smart choice for the budget-conscious driver in 2026, offering a clear path to how to improve fuel efficiency. Smart Use of Cabin Comforts
We all want to stay comfortable while driving, but there is a trade-off between climate control and fuel economy. Air conditioning is a major power drain on the engine. While using it is necessary in the heat, being mindful of your settings can help. At lower speeds, opening the windows might be more efficient than running the AC; however, at highway speeds, the aerodynamic drag caused by open windows can actually be less efficient than using the AC. Planning and Combining Trips: Efficiency Through Logistics
Frequent, short trips are notoriously bad for fuel economy because the engine never reaches its optimal operating temperature. When an engine is cold, it operates in a "rich" fuel state, meaning it uses more gas to warm up the catalytic converter and internal components, a major hurdle for how to improve fuel efficiency. The "Cold Start" Problem
A cold engine is inherently inefficient. If you make five short trips throughout the day, you force the engine to go through the warm-up cycle five times. By grouping your errands together into one "loop," you allow the engine to stay warm throughout the journey, which significantly improves your overall MPG, a smart tactic for how to improve fuel efficiency (Source 4).
- Map your route: Before leaving the house, organize your stops to minimize backtracking.
- Order of operations: Hit the destination furthest from home first, then work your way back. This ensures the engine is fully warmed up during the bulk of your driving.

Selecting the Recommended Viscosity
Every vehicle manufacturer specifies a recommended oil viscosity—typically found in your owner's manual or on the oil fill cap (e.g., 5W-30 or 0W-20). Using a thicker oil than recommended increases internal engine drag because the oil pump must work harder to circulate the fluid.
- Energy-Conserving Labels: Look for oil containers that display the "API Resource Conserving" symbol. These oils are formulated with friction-reducing additives that allow the engine to slide more freely, reducing energy loss.
- The Synthetic Advantage: Synthetic oils generally have a more uniform molecular structure, providing better flow at startup and less breakdown under extreme heat. Aerodynamics: Reducing the Drag Coefficient
At highway speeds, the primary force resisting your car’s movement is not friction with the road, but aerodynamic drag. Once you cross the 45-50 mph threshold, your car spends more energy pushing air out of the way than it does overcoming rolling resistance, a major consideration for how to improve fuel efficiency.
Eliminating External Accessories
Roof racks, bike carriers, and cargo boxes are incredibly convenient, but they are aerodynamic disasters. Even an empty roof rack can reduce your fuel economy by several percentage points because of the turbulent air it creates, making its removal a simple way for how to improve fuel efficiency. Body Maintenance and Repairs
If your car has sustained front-end damage, such as a loose bumper or a missing air dam (the plastic piece under the front bumper), your fuel efficiency will suffer. These components are designed by engineers to guide air around the vehicle and under the engine bay efficiently. Replacing damaged trim pieces isn't just about aesthetics; it's about restoring the aerodynamic profile that the engineers intended for your model, a subtle but important factor in how to improve fuel efficiency.

Manual vs. Digital Tracking
While many modern vehicles come equipped with an onboard computer that displays your current and average MPG, these systems can sometimes be optimistic.
- The "Old School" Method: Fill your tank to the brim, note the odometer reading, and reset your trip meter. The next time you fill up, note the gallons added and the new odometer reading. Divide the miles driven by the gallons added to get your true MPG.
- Mobile Apps: There are numerous apps available where you can log your fuel-ups. Over time, these apps will generate graphs showing your efficiency trends. If you notice a sudden dip in your MPG, it is often a sign that a maintenance issue—like low tire pressure or a failing sensor—is developing, which can hinder your efforts on how to improve fuel efficiency.

Coasting and Anticipation
Instead of driving right up to a red light or a stop sign and hitting the brakes at the last second, learn to "pulse and glide." When you see a red light a block ahead, take your foot off the gas early and allow the vehicle to coast down to a stop.
- Why it works: Every time you use the brake, you are converting the kinetic energy you spent fuel to create into useless heat. By coasting, you maximize the use of the energy you've already paid for, a fundamental principle of how to improve fuel efficiency.
- Maintain momentum: On the highway, try to keep your speed as constant as possible. Avoid the "accordion effect" where you catch up to the car in front of you and then have to brake, only to accelerate again once they move. Leaving a larger following distance gives you the space to adjust your speed smoothly rather than aggressively.

Evaluating Fuel Types: Octane and Ethanol
There is a common misconception that higher octane gas provides more power and better fuel economy for every vehicle, a myth to debunk when discussing how to improve fuel efficiency. For the vast majority of cars, this is simply not true.
Following the Manufacturer’s Specification
If your car is designed to run on regular 87-octane fuel, putting premium in it will not improve your MPG. Premium fuel is formulated to prevent "knocking" in high-compression or turbocharged engines; if your engine doesn't require it, you are effectively paying a premium for no performance or efficiency benefit. Always check your owner's manual for the fuel requirement, a simple step in understanding how to improve fuel efficiency for your specific model. If it says "recommended," you can use regular, but you may see a slight drop in performance; if it says "required," use what the manufacturer demands to maintain the efficiency standards the engine was designed for.
Ethanol Content Considerations
In many regions, gasoline is blended with ethanol (e.g., E10 or E15). Ethanol contains less energy per gallon than pure gasoline. If your vehicle is "Flex-Fuel" capable, you might notice that your fuel efficiency drops when using E85 (85% ethanol) compared to standard E10 gasoline. While E85 is often cheaper, the lower energy density often means you have to fill up more frequently. Calculate your "cost per mile" by dividing the price of the fuel by the MPG you achieve on that specific blend to see which is truly the better deal for your wallet and optimize how to improve fuel efficiency (Source 1).

Eco-Mode Settings
Most vehicles manufactured in the last few years include an "Eco-Mode" button. When activated, this mode adjusts several parameters of the vehicle's operation:
- Throttle mapping: The engine becomes less sensitive to minor fluctuations in your foot pressure, preventing accidental "jackrabbit" starts.
- Transmission logic: The transmission may shift into higher gears sooner to keep engine RPMs lower.
- Climate control adjustment: The AC system may run at a lower intensity to reduce the load on the engine.

Start-Stop Technology
If your car is equipped with Automatic Start-Stop technology, you might find it annoying, but it is one of the most effective ways to save fuel in heavy stop-and-go traffic. It automatically kills the engine when you are at a complete stop and restarts it instantly when you lift your foot from the brake. If you are tempted to disable this feature, remember that the constant idling in traffic is the single largest contributor to wasted fuel in urban environments. The Warm-Up Myth
Many people believe that letting a car idle in the driveway for 10 minutes on a cold morning "warms up the engine." This is outdated advice. Modern fuel-injected engines only need about 30 seconds of idling before they are ready to be driven.
- The reality: The best way to warm up your engine is to drive it gently. Avoid high RPMs or heavy acceleration for the first few miles.
- The winter drop: Your fuel economy will naturally drop in winter because of the higher electrical load (seat heaters, defrosters, wipers), the thicker viscosity of cold oil, and the change in air density, making it harder to maintain how to improve fuel efficiency.
Tire Pressure and Temperature Drops
As temperatures drop, the air inside your tires contracts, leading to a loss in PSI. For every 10-degree Fahrenheit drop in temperature, your tire pressure can drop by about 1 PSI. If you don't check your tires during the first cold snap, you could be driving on significantly under-inflated tires for months. Calculating Your Annual Savings
If you drive 15,000 miles a year and improve your fuel efficiency from 20 MPG to 24 MPG, you reduce your annual fuel consumption by 125 gallons. At a price of $4.00 per gallon, that is $500 in your pocket every single year. The Environmental Dividend
Beyond the financial rewards, improving your fuel economy is a tangible way to reduce your carbon footprint. Every gallon of gasoline you don't burn keeps approximately 20 pounds of carbon dioxide out of the atmosphere.
